Also known as siot
Siot (letter: ㅅ; South Korean name: ; North Korean name: ) is a consonant of the Korean alphabet. Siot indicates an sound like in the English word "staff", but at the end of a syllable it denotes a sound. Before , semivowels (like ㅛ, yo) and the vowel ㅟ (wi) it is pronounced .

ㅅ (en coreano, 시옷, siot, en norcoreano: 시읏, sieut) es una consonante del alfabeto coreano. El Unicode para ㅅ es U+3137. Siot indica un sonido [s] como en la palabra "sol", pero al final de una sílaba denota un sonido [t]. Antes de [i], las semivocales (como ㅛ, yo ) y la vocal ㅟ (ui) se pronuncia [ɕ].
